Isaiah 63:17-19
Jubilee Bible 2000
17 O LORD, why hast thou made us to err from thy ways? Hast thou hardened our heart to thy fear? Return for thy slaves, for the tribes of thine inheritance.
18 The people of thy holiness have possessed the promised land but a little while: our adversaries have trodden down thy sanctuary.
19 We have been like those over whom thou didst never rule, who were never called by thy name.

Isaiah 63:17-19
New International Version
17 Why, Lord, do you make us wander(A) from your ways
and harden our hearts(B) so we do not revere(C) you?
Return(D) for the sake of your servants,
the tribes that are your inheritance.(E)
18 For a little while(F) your people possessed your holy place,
but now our enemies have trampled(G) down your sanctuary.(H)
19 We are yours from of old;
but you have not ruled over them,
they have not been called[a] by your name.(I)
Footnotes
- Isaiah 63:19 Or We are like those you have never ruled, / like those never called
